Roxanne Brown Obituary

Age 56 of Lindstrom, formerly of White Bear, MN Passed away peacefully surrounded by her family. She devoted her life to caring and educating her students in the 916 program along with other volunteering. She is preceded in death by her parents Bob and DonnaHardy, brother Nels and sister Renee. She is survived by her devoted husband of 39 years, Dave and their children Dave (Jenny) and Brian (Kari); grandchildren: Brandon, Jake, Alex, Jenna, Hayden, Jada, Ryan, and Ruby; siblings Cookie (Chuck), Don (Addie), Cindy (D.J.), Robin (Randy), Jackie (Jim), many other nieces, nephews and extended family. A celebration of her life will be held at 6:00 p.m., Tuesday, November 2, 2010 at Mattson Funeral Home, 343 North Shore Drive, Forest Lake. The family will greet friends from 3 p.m. until time of service at the funeral home. In lieu of flowers, memorials preferred. The family has requested in honor of Roxi's unique style, please dress casual, colorful and fun, not to forget your earrings. www.mattsonfuneralhome
